Output 783717a41d0935f3c757ecc829af626529009bb6dbcf1134afa1e1ea210d0035:1

value
108322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e46c465a0c69daf90f8a85f91b27409919b79c OP_EQUAL
address
3CXfJHT7uitCVBsuPqBGpvF4RbhvWhfQ2U
transaction
783717a41d0935f3c757ecc829af626529009bb6dbcf1134afa1e1ea210d0035
confirmations
312955
spent
true